    Ok here\'s the deal. These are made from an original tooling master straight from Don Post studios. Basically, you are getting a blank helmet casting perfect and ready for primer and paint and decals. Original decals included as well. This is essentially a 1500$ Don Post deluxe helmet that sold in the mid 90s for a fraction of the cost. Call it a reissue under the table if you will

    No pictures because it is off being molded by a professional mold maker and caster.

    I already posted this at the RPF but figured i\'d post here just in case.. 2 spots left


    250$ per pull

    I can provide pics of an original DP deluxe if you want. There will be no difference in size and detail!!!!!

    Ahh the ole roto mold, I have a roto molding machine, there is two ways if he is putting it in a oven then it is thermal plastic, if not a oven then it is urethane with a 80 or thereabouts shore rating.. or like the old Don Post mask with slipcast, .. nice piece, is it the same size as the original or is it smaller?..
